Common Core Standards:
CCSS.MATH.CONTENT.1.MD.C.4:
Organize,
represent, and interpret data with up to three categories; ask and answer questions
about the total number of data points, how many in each category, and how many
more or less are in one category than in another.

Goal:
To provide
students with a sorting and data collecting activity
Materials Needed:
1. M & M’s
2. Coloring utensils
3. Worksheet – graph and
sorting mat
Explanation/Summary:
Students will be
given a bag of M & M’s that they will sort and then count to find the
amount of each color of M & M. Then on their graph they will record the
data by shading in a rectangle over the color that they are recording for each
M & M of that color. There are some questions that also go along with this.
Students will graph the data and then use their graph to answer the questions
